GT
Destination Port

Puerto Quetzal

Infrastructure Highlights

  • Purpose-built container terminal with ship-to-shore cranes
  • High-draft berths suitable for Panamax and post-Panamax vessels
  • Integrated customs and inspection facilities for expedited cargo clearance
  • Truck-accessible yard areas providing immediate access to Guatemala City and the interior

Key Imports

Petroleum products and fuelsMachinery and industrial equipmentVehicles and automotive partsConsumer goods and electronicsFertilizers and chemical products

Import Regulations

Imports are subject to Guatemalan customs law, including detailed declarations and compliance with applicable duties and taxes.
